Reading the Welcome Bonus Before You Click "Claim"
The no deposit online casino bonus is the single biggest hook for new Singapore players, and also the single biggest source of day-one frustration. Here's what the bonus page actually means when you read between the lines.
Wagering requirement (WR): The multiplier on the bonus credit you have to "turn over" before withdrawal. A 30x WR on an S$8 NDB means you need to place S$240 in qualifying bets before the bonus converts to withdrawable cash. Normal. 50x+ WR is where most players burn out.
Max cashout cap: Most no-deposit bonuses cap how much of the bonus balance you can eventually withdraw. If the cap is S$50 and you've somehow turned S$8 into S$200, you walk away with S$50. The rest is forfeited. Read this number.
Eligible games: Bonus credit usually only contributes to wagering on specific game categories. Live dealer baccarat often counts 100% but excludes "opposite" bets (Banker + Player, Big + Small — these don't count toward wagering). Slots from major providers like Pragmatic, JILI, and Spade Gaming typically count 100%. Some fishing-style games on 918Kiss and SCR888 don't count at all.
Game contribution rates: Even within "eligible games," contribution varies. Live casino baccarat might count 100%, while roulette covering more than 30 numbers or paired opposites (red/black, odd/even) doesn't contribute. Check the fine print.

The fastest way to waste a no deposit bonus is to bet on excluded games, hit a "win," then try to withdraw — only to find the wagering requirement was never actually being met. I see this in my group once a week.
